ZLV welcomes Brazilian researcher

Dr. Rômulo Dante Orrico Filho, professor for Public Transport with the department of Traffic Technology (PET) at the Alberto Luiz Coimbra Institute (COPPE) was visiting the Centre for Logistics & Traffic (ZLV) last week.

COPPE is Latin America's largest Institute for Graduate Studies and Research in Engineering and is part of the renowned Federal University of Rio de Janeiro (UFRJ).

The reason behind the visit was an exchange with members of the ZLV chair for Transport Systems and Logistics, the ZLV coordination office and DIALOGistic Duisburg as well as the Niederrhein Chamber for Industry and Commerce and the port of Duisburg. Core of the talks was the development of new strategic perspectives and the inter- and indisciplinary cooperation of logistics partners from the public domain, industry and academia – in Brazil as well as in Germany.

The exchange will be continued during the 1. European Forum for Logistic Clusters, taking place in Brussels on the 14th and 15th of October 2014 as a conclusion of the EU project LOG4GREEN.
